This Cheesy Baked Chicken Has A Surprise Ingredient That Makes It Absolutely Outstanding!

INGREDIENTS

  • 6 boneless, skinless chicken breasts
  • 1 1/2 cups sharp cheddar cheese, grated
  • 3/4 cup whole milk
  • 1/2 cup parmesan cheese, grated
  • 3 tablespoons unsalted butter
  • 2 tablespoons all-purpose flour
  • 1 1/2 tablespoons whole grain mustard
  • 1/2 teaspoon garlic powder
  • Kosher salt and freshly ground pepper, to taste
  • Taste and adjust seasoning, if necessary.

 

PREPARATION

  1. Preheat oven to 375º F.
  2. Season chicken breasts generously with salt and pepper and place in a large baking dish.
  3. Cover with aluminum foil, place in oven and bake for 20 minutes.
  4. In a large saucepan, melt butter over medium heat and whisk in flour. Cook roux for 2 minutes, stirring constantly, or until smooth, paste-like, and golden in color.
  5. Remove pan from heat and gradually whisk in whole milk until smooth. Return to heat and bring to a boil.
  6. Reduce heat to low and let sauce simmer for 5-7 minutes, or until thickened.
  7. Remove chicken from oven and evenly pour sauce over the top.
  8. Return to oven and bake for another 25-30 minutes, or until chicken is cooked all the way through, but still tender.
  9. Remove from oven, serve hot and enjoy!
